Phloridzin, also known as phloretin glucoside, is a naturally occurring dihydrochalcone glycoside primarily found in the bark and leaves of apple trees (Malus domestica) and other members of the Rosaceae family. Its chemical identity is defined by the molecular formula C21H24O10 and the CAS registry number 53-97-0. Structurally, it consists of the aglycone phloretin linked to a glucose molecule at the C-6 position, which significantly influences its solubility and biological activity compared to its non-glycosylated counterpart.
In the realm of scientific research, Phloridzin has garnered substantial attention for its potent inhibitory effects on sodium-dependent glucose transporters (SGLTs), particularly SGLT1 and SGLT2. This mechanism makes it a valuable tool for studying glucose metabolism and renal physiology. By blocking the reabsorption of glucose in the proximal tubules of the kidney, it mimics the action of modern anti-diabetic drugs, leading to increased urinary glucose excretion. Consequently, it serves as a critical reference compound in the development of therapies for type 2 diabetes and obesity. Beyond metabolic applications, Phloridzin exhibits notable antioxidant and anti-inflammatory properties, contributing to its investigation in neuroprotection and skin health formulations.
Commercially and industrially, this compound is utilized in the production of dietary supplements aimed at blood sugar regulation and weight management. It is also employed in cosmetic science for its potential to inhibit melanogenesis, offering benefits for skin brightening and pigmentation control. While generally regarded as safe in controlled doses, its bioavailability can be limited due to extensive metabolism in the gut and liver. Researchers continue to explore prodrug strategies to enhance its therapeutic efficacy.
